The nurse is planning anticipatory guidance for a caregiver of a preschool-age child. The nurse will explain that permanent teeth begin erupting at what age?
 
  a. 4 years old
  b. 6 years old
  c. 8 years old
  d. 10 years old

At a well-baby visit, parents of a 6-month-old ask when to take the infant for the first dental visit. What is the nurse's best response?
 
  a. If the teeth are brushed regularly, the child should see a dentist by 3 years of age.
  b. The first dental visit should be arranged after the first tooth erupts.
  c. The child should have a dental examination when all deciduous teeth have erupted.
  d. A dental visit by 1 year of age is recommended by the American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ry.

Answer to Question 1

ANS: B
Permanent teeth do not erupt through the gums until the sixth year.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: D
The Academy of Pediatric Dentistry recommends that the first dental visit occur by 1 year of age.

Blastomycosis is often misdiagnosed, resulting in tragic outcomes. It is caused by a fungus living in moist soil, in wooded areas of the United States and Canada. If inhaled, the fungus can cause mild breathing problems that may worsen and cause serious illness and even death.
